The labels "counseling" and "therapy" serve as catch-alls for a variety of methods of managing mental health issues. They entail private one-on-one or group sessions with an expert in mental health, such as a psychologist, counselor, social worker, or psychiatrist. Why these services are necessary are as follows:
1. Emotional Support and Validation: Counseling and therapy offer people a secure and accepting environment in which to communicate their emotions, ideas, and worries. You can be heard and accepted there, which makes it easier for you to feel less alone in your troubles.
2. Developing Coping Skills: Mental health specialists give their patients practical coping mechanisms to deal with stress, anxiety, depression, and other emotional difficulties. These abilities can be quite helpful in handling the ups and downs of life.
3. Determining Underlying Issues: Many times, mental health problems have hidden origins that are not always obvious. People might examine their prior events, traumas, or thought patterns that have contributed to their current problems through counseling and therapy.
4. Better Relationships: Therapy can assist people in improving their communication skills and resolving interpersonal difficulties. Being more aware of oneself makes it simpler to interact with others in a positive way.
5. Mental Health Education: Therapists and counselors offer information about mental health issues, symptoms, and available therapies. People are more equipped to choose actions that will promote their mental health thanks to this understanding.
6. Tailored Treatment programs: Therapists design individualized treatment programs based on each patient's particular requirements and objectives. By using a customized approach, it is ensured that the techniques used are the best fit for the individual.
7. Crisis Intervention: Mental health experts can offer urgent support and direction to help people achieve stability and safety during times of acute distress or crisis.
